Urban Xtreme in Brisbane feels completely neglected when it comes to the under-fives area. What’s meant to be a space for little ones is rundown, poorly maintained, and clearly an afterthought. Several parts of the play area are broken, and there’s next to nothing that actually entertains or engages children in this age range. It gives the impression that it hasn’t been properly cared for or updated in a long time. What’s worse, there’s an emergency exit with a low handle that opens straight into the car park — a serious safety hazard for toddlers. It’s shocking that this hasn’t been addressed. The bathroom facilities were also in poor condition — unclean, and out of five women’s toilets, only one had toilet paper. It really summed up the overall lack of attention and care across the venue. The staff seem undertrained and unable to manage even simple requests without waiting for a manager to step in, and the café food is inconsistent and low quality. The overall vibe is one of neglect and disorganisation rather than fun and family-friendly. And while the height limit may technically allow kids 7-10 yrs on the Ninja course, the reality is that most can’t even reach the equipment, making it more frustrating than enjoyable. For families with younger children, I strongly recommend choosing another venue. There are far better-maintained and genuinely child-friendly places in Brisbane that care about safety, hygiene, and engagement — all things Urban Xtreme seems to have forgotten.
